Bit-vex.com

Investment scams
https://bit-vex.com

Bit-vex.com is a front for an investment scam, promising high returns on initial deposits. The website, flagged as fraudulent just 65 days after its launch, lacks both social media presence and genuine reviews. Phone numbers listed are non-functional, raising further suspicions. Investors are lured in with the promise of substantial profits, only to have their money vanish without a trace.

An investment scam is a fraudulent scheme where scammers promise high returns to lure people into investing money, which they then steal.

Investment scams are fraudulent schemes that promise high returns with little risk. Scammers often lure victims with guarantees of quick profits or exclusive opportunities. They may use convincing testimonials or fake credentials to build trust. Victims might be pressured to act quickly, creating a sense of urgency. Scammers often claim that the opportunity is limited or time-sensitive. They might use complex jargon to confuse and impress potential investors. Communication is usually conducted through emails, phone calls, or social media. Scammers may ask for personal information or upfront fees. They often disappear once they have collected money. These scams can target anyone, regardless of their financial knowledge. The promise of easy money can be tempting, making it easier for scammers to exploit unsuspecting individuals.
